Dave Inc (DAVE) stock soared 8.45% in pre-market trading on Wednesday, following the release of its impressive second-quarter 2025 financial results. The fintech company's strong performance across key metrics has sparked investor enthusiasm, driving the significant uptick in share price.

The earnings report revealed that Dave achieved a net income of $9.1 million for the quarter, marking a notable profitability milestone. Revenue for Q2 reached $131.7 million, indicating robust growth in the company's user base and service adoption. Additionally, Dave reported an adjusted EBITDA of $50.9 million, showcasing the company's improving operational efficiency and financial health.

These positive financial indicators suggest that Dave's strategy to expand its financial services platform and attract more users is yielding favorable results. The pre-market surge reflects investors' optimism about the company's growth trajectory and its potential to capture a larger share of the competitive fintech market.
